About The Role
Due to continuing strong growth, we have a great opportunity for a Project Director to join our Adelaide team.
As a key member of our team, you will be responsible for tasks including but not limited to:
- Control expenditure and revenue to maximise profitability.
- Reviewing and evaluating legislative changes and updating relevant documents.
- Obtain all necessary statutory approvals and permits prior to commencement of works.
- Administer and implement the Project Execution Plan, ensuring that all requirements of the Plan are implemented and that all activities are performed in compliance with the requirements of the relevant specifications, codes and standards which form part of the contract.
- Select subcontractors and suppliers based on an evaluation of their ability to meet the specified requirements including those for safety, quality and environmental and ensure compliance with same.
- Ensure that all subcontractors are advised of their obligations set out in the contractual documents, and that those obligations are met.
- Ensure that all personnel are inducted in their roles and responsibilities in accordance with the requirements of the Project Execution Plan and all attachments.
- Maintain effective relations with the Client throughout the project.
- Compilation of a comprehensive project close-out report at the completion of the project.
About you
To Be Successful In This Role You Will Have
- Relevant tertiary qualification (Construction and Economics Management or Civil Engineering) or relevant industry experience.
- A minimum of fifteen years’ experience in the commercial construction industry, projects greater than 40 mill, with a demonstrated success in delivering to financial targets, timeframes, planning and logistics management.
- Strong leadership and communication abilities translated into the achievement by staff of individual and team performance objectives and measurement targets.
- Competent in understanding and promoting HSEQ imperatives and MMS procedures.
- Competent in negotiation and client relationship building accompanied with a sound understanding of contract management and cost containment.
- Demonstrates flexibility and resilience in dealing with complex issues, looks for approach change and deploys sound problem solving methodology.
- Competent in use of MS Word, Excel and PowerPoint.
